Overview
Protect Your Electronics with Reliable Surge Protection
Introducing the GE 14713 2140J 8-Outlet Block Phone/FAX/Modem Surge Protector. This premium surge protector is designed to safeguard your small household electronics from voltage spikes and surges.
Specifications
- Outlets: 8
- Surge Protection: 2140 Joules
- Protection Type: Phone/FAX/Modem
- Application: Small Household Electronics
Key Features
Premium surge protector is perfect for small household electronics
4 standard outlets and 4 AC outlets
2140 joules
Surge protection "on" indicator light
3 foot cord with wall hugger plug
